New IEEE Standard – Active. The neutral grounding of single- and three-phase ac electric utility primary distribution systems with nominal voltages in the range of 2.4–34.5 kV is addressed. Classes of distribution systems grounding are defined. Basic considerations in distribution system grounding–concerning economics, control of temporary overvoltages, control of ground-fault currents, and ground relaying–are addressed. Also considered are use of grounding transformers, grounding of high-voltage neutral of wye\/delta distribution transformers, and interconnection of primary and secondary neutrals of distribution transformers.<\/p>\n
